Apartment living in Dallas is a great experience, but some nights you want to get, dress up, and hang around with the city's beautiful people in a cool, modern environment. The Ghostbar, one of Dallas's most chic and popular bar is for people looking for some refreshing drinks and a swinging crowd, and with all the ambiance and great service, you're sure to feel like a star from the moment you walk in. The bar brings in a crowd nearly every night, so be warned the lines may be long. Also, by warned that this bar caters to a certain kind of clientele, so if you show up in shorts and tennis shoes, you're more than a little likely to get the boot. If you're a beautiful woman, you're a shoe-in for a spot in the bar, since the woman get the best treatment here, with no cover anytime. It's a terrific spot for some people watching, since the place has a habit of gathering together all the most beautiful people in town. There's even a chance that you'll run into some celebrities while you're here. For those looking for a good view of the Dallas skyline, there are very few places better. Whether you're dancing the night away, or enjoying some drinks, there's always an opportunity to take advantage of this 33rd-floor club, which rises you above all the clamor of the city to the sky, giving you a panoramic view of the city beneath you. You can even enjoy drinks on the ghost deck, with crystal clear floors and walls, you will feel like you're walking on air, with the beautiful city all around you. For those in the mood for a nice cocktail, make sure to try their trademark ghostitas or ghostinis, or find something delicious off the extensive wine list. Gorgeous people, refreshing drinks, and the best view in town converge to create one of the best evening out in Dallas. Dallas apartment-ites looking for a chic, modern club with cool, polite service and great music, above the hustle and bustle of the city, Ghostbar is the right place for you.
Frequently Asked Questions about Dallas
How much are Studio apartments in Dallas?
There are currently 655 Studio Apartments in Dallas with rent ranges from $625 to $6,164 with an average price of $1,518.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Dallas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Dallas ranges from $325 to $24,123 with an average monthly rent of $1,718.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Dallas c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Dallas range from $627 to $24,537.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,353.
How expensive are Dallas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 1,165 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Dallas on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$627 to $28,642 - averaging $3,151 for the location.
